Everyone,
    I think I may have tied together all the pieces of why I have been
seeing IVTV drop buffers and MythTV stating that is is IOBOUND when
recording off of multiple tuners. Posting to both lists in hopes of
helping others.

    It appears there is an issue with the Ext3 filesystems and multiple
streaming writers causing performance problems. There is a patch for
this in the -mm kernel tree (called the reservation  patch), which
resolves the issue. I haven't tried it, however. 

    Suggested work arounds at the moment are to either use the patch
from -mm or to use a different filesystem.
